深入理解Shadowrocket PAC模式的使用与配置

什么是Shadowrocket?

Shadowrocket是一个强大的网络代理工具,主要用于iOS设备。它允许用户通过代理服务器访问互联网,从而实现安全与隐私保护。该应用基于Socks5和ShadowSocks协议而设计,功能齐全,界面友好,对于追求访问自由的用户而言无疑是一个好选择。

PAC模式的简要介绍

PAC(Proxy Auto Configuration)模式是Shadowrocket中用于自动选择代理服务器的一种机制。它帮助用户根据设定的规则自动选择适当的代理,从而有效管理网络流量。

PAC模式的优点

  • 自动化管理:通过规则自动选择代理,用户无需手动切换。
  • 精准控制:根据特定URL对代理进行选择,提高访问效率。
  • 节省流量:可以避免不必要的流量消耗。

Shadowrocket PAC模式的配置步骤

在使用Shadowrocket的PAC模式之前,用户需要完成以下准备工作。

第一步:下载Shadowrocket

  1. 在iOS设备上打开App Store。
  2. 搜索“Shadowrocket”。
  3. 点击下载并安装应用。

第二步:获取PAC文件

PAC文件是配置PAC模式的关键文件,可以通过以下途径获取:

  • 在线PAC文件:很多网站提供免费的PAC文件链接。
  • 自己编写:如果你有能力,可以自己编写PAC文件。

第三步:添加PAC文件到Shadowrocket

  1. 打开Shadowrocket应用。
  2. 点击“配置”选项。
  3. 选择“添加配置”。
  4. 输入“PAC”作为类型,粘贴获取的PAC文件链接。
  5. 点击“完成”。

第四步:开启PAC模式

  1. 在Shadowrocket首界面,找到新添加的PAC配置。
  2. 开启该配置,确保其为活动状态。
  3. 测试连接,确保能够正常通过配置的代理访问互联网。

如何测试PAC模式在Shadowrocket中的有效性

为了确保PAC模式配置正确,可以进行以下测试:

  • 访问检测:打开浏览器,访问一个需要使用代理的网站。如果能正常加载,配置就成功了。
  • 查看日志:在应用中查看具体的连接日志,确保可以看到代理状态。

Shadowrocket PAC模式的注意事项

  • 稳定性:选择的PAC来源应该可靠,以确保稳定性。
  • 更新周期:一些PAC文件需要定期更新,保持其最新有效。可以设置定时更新功能。
  • 环境限制:在某些特定环境(例如公司网络)中,可能会有协议限制,配置可能需要调整。

常见问题解答(FAQ)

Q1:如何手动编辑PAC文件?

手动编辑PAC文件需要一定的JavaScript基础,主要步骤包括:

  • 打开文本编辑器。
  • 按照PAC语法定义规则。
  • 可通过function FindProxyForURL(url, host)作为入口。

Q2:撤回PAC文件后,如何恢复到原始设置?

在Shadowrocket中,找到已添加的PAC配置,选择删选按钮移除该配置即可恢复原始设置。

Q3:PAC模式和全局模式的区别是什么?

  • PAC模式根据规则选择特定代理,而全局模式即对所有流量无差别使用相同的代理。
  • PAC模式更加灵活多变,可以选择性使用。

总结

通过本文的指导,相信你已经掌握了如何在Shadowrocket中设置和使用PAC模式。利用PAC模式的自动化特性,你将能够更加高效地管理网络访问。记住,随时关注PAC文件的更新,确保你的连接安全、稳定,同时享受自由的互联网环境!

正文完
 0